Developing an Effective Gym Routine: How Many Hours Should You Spend in the Gym?

Before you start your gym routine, it’s important to understand your goals. Are you looking to lose weight, gain muscle, or just stay healthy and fit? Knowing your goals will help you create an effective workout plan that will help you reach them. Once you’ve identified your goals, you can start to look at the best ways to achieve them.

When it comes to working out, it’s important to find the right balance between intensity and duration. Working out too hard for too long can lead to burnout and injury, while not working out hard enough won’t give you the results you’re looking for. To find the right balance, you should calculate the minimum amount of time needed for an effective workout. Depending on your goals and fitness level, this could range from 30 minutes to an hour.

Once you’ve determined the minimum amount of time needed for an effective workout, you can start to look at ways to maximize your results. One of the most important concepts to understand is progressive overload. This refers to gradually increasing the intensity of your workouts over time as your body adapts and becomes stronger. This will help you get the most out of your workouts and ensure that you’re reaching your goals.

Knowing the concept of progressive overload is key to understanding the ideal amount of time to spend in the gym. The more intense your workouts, the shorter the duration should be. For example, if you’re doing high-intensity interval training, you should aim for 15-30 minutes of exercise. On the other hand, if you’re doing a more moderate workout, you can increase the duration to 45 minutes or more.

Optimizing Your Training: How Long Should You Spend in the Gym?

It’s also important to know your limits when it comes to working out. If you’re feeling tired or sore, it’s important to take a break and allow your body to recover. Taking regular rest days is crucial for avoiding injury and ensuring that you’re getting the most out of your workouts. Additionally, it’s important to make sure that you’re utilizing different types of workouts, such as strength training, cardio, and stretching, so that you’re targeting all areas of your fitness.

Making the Most of Your Workouts: Calculating the Ideal Time to Spend in the Gym

When it comes to calculating the ideal time to spend in the gym, it’s important to track your progress. This will help you identify which exercises are working and where you need to focus your efforts. As you track your progress, you should adjust your routine as needed to ensure that you’re making the most of your workouts. Additionally, if you find that you’re not seeing results, you may need to increase the intensity of your workouts or increase the amount of time you’re spending in the gym.
